I normally don't draw stuff like this and I'm not too "comfortable" about it yet, but someone special told me to try to draw this way.Which is to draw my disability.
This little tortoise is a symbol for me.
It's something I struggle with daily, so I guess you can say I carry this tortoise where ever I go.
The tortoise represents my brain, my learning disability.
They say it affects my ability to learn things, specifically in school. Sure, it truly does make school work EXTREMELY difficult.
It didn't seem fair to me in school, since I had to work twice as hard than anyone else around me just to meet the regular standards.
I feel as if this affects me in almost anything I do, not just in school. Whether it's; communication, drawing, repeating after a song, learning a new skill etc.
In other words, my brain process takes a little longer than "normal" I guess you can say.
This tortoise does not affect me physically in any way what so ever but mentally it does.
Despite all the struggles I had in the past, though I do still continue to struggle...in the end, I know I will get to the end of that race. Sure, everyone might have beat me to the finish line, but what's important to me is that I still keep going until I finish. I will cross that finish line at my own pace, I shall not be discouraged. Nor will I stop in the middle of a race and quit.
